This vibrant creature design presents a playful and imaginative character that blends elements of dragon and dinosaur-like features with a friendly demeanor. The central figure stands confidently, its round belly and sturdy legs suggesting strength balanced with approachability. The warm color palette of muted reds, creamy whites, and deep oranges adds a sense of warmth and energy, complemented by darker shades accentuating the wings and extremities, which enhances the overall depth of the character. The character’s eye, highlighted in bright yellow and white, conveys a spark of curiosity and intelligence. The detail given to the wing structure, with prominent orange highlights on the edges, reveals a thoughtful design that suggests both function and style. Its thick claws are bold but softened by the rounded shapes of the hands and feet, blending toughness with a welcoming posture. Additional line sketches shown alongside the colored figure offer a glimpse into the character’s expressive capabilities, revealing playful and endearing facial expressions that add layers of personality and potential story.
